What to Do Right After a Car Accident in Oklahoma City
Safety comes first. Move to a safe location if you can, and call 911 to report the accident. Oklahoma law requires drivers to report collisions that involve injury, death, or significant property damage. A police report creates an official record that may become critical evidence later. Do not admit fault or speculate about the cause of the crash while at the scene.
Once you are safe, exchange information with all drivers involved. Collect full names, contact details, driver's license numbers, license plate numbers, and insurance information.
How Should You Collect Evidence at the Scene?
Strong evidence often starts at the scene. Document everything you can before vehicles are moved, if it is safe to do so.
Photograph the following:
▸ Vehicle damage from multiple angles.
▸ Skid marks and road conditions.
▸ Traffic signs, signals, and intersection layout.
▸ Any visible injuries you have sustained.
▸ The surrounding area, including weather and lighting conditions.
Ask any witnesses for their names and phone numbers. Witness accounts may corroborate your version of events later in the claims process. Note the names and badge numbers of responding officers as well.

Prioritizing Medical Care After a Collision
Seeking medical attention right away is one of the most important steps after any crash. Some injuries may not be immediately obvious. Conditions like whiplash, soft tissue damage, or internal trauma can take hours or days to produce clear symptoms. A medical provider can document your injuries and establish a timeline that connects them to the accident. This documentation may be essential when working with a personal injury law attorney in Oklahoma City, OK, to build a strong claim.
Do not delay care, even if you feel fine at the scene. A gap in treatment can give insurers reason to argue that your injuries were not serious or were unrelated to the accident.

Why Medical Records Matter in a Personal Injury Case
Medical records serve as direct evidence linking your injuries to the crash. They can support claims for current treatment costs, future care needs, and non-economic damages like pain and suffering.
